Palestinian president, in front of Putin, rules out US as Mideast peace mediator during speech
Fox News
The president of Palestine, Mahmoud Abbas, denounced the United States as being a mediator of peace in the Middle East during a speech where Vladimir Putin was present.
"We don't trust the U.S.," Abbas said, speaking in Arabic, as Putin looked on. "We don't accept the U.S., under any condition, (as) a single party in solving the Middle East problem," he added.
He said the Palestinians would only consider U.S. mediation if it were part of the "Quartet," a grouping of nations that includes Russia.
